Summary of the contracting process

The Department for Education (DfE) in the United Kingdom is in the planning stage of a procurement process titled "World Skills UK market research" under the services category of education and training. The opportunity is centrally focused on understanding the supplier market related to technical and vocational education. The procurement is managed at the Department's Sanctuary Buildings in London. The initial engagement deadline is scheduled for 4th July 2025, and the future communication date is anticipated on 1st October 2025. The process involves a Request for Information (RFI) to gather insights, which will then inform the strategic direction of the WorldSkills UK programme. The contract period is projected to start on 1st April 2026 and run through to 31st March 2028, with potential renewals extending to March 2029.

Notice Description

The purpose of this notice is to refresh the Department for Education (DfE)'s market intelligence to understand more about the supplier market, particularly covering public sector aspects of technical and vocational teaching, learning and assessment, competitions, events and fundraising. DfE grant funds a non-governmental organisation (NGO) to operate as WorldSkills UK (WSUK). This organisation is funded to be the government's representative body in WorldSkills International and WorldSkills Europe, participate in international skills competitions and to use the insights gained to raise standards of teaching, learning and assessment across the sector. The main deliverables of WSUK are: 1. Representing the UK in international discussion, debate and negotiation around global technical standards and the development of international labour policy. 2. Using insights gained from membership of WorldSkills International and WorldSkills Europe to raise standards of teaching, learning and assessment across the sector. 3. Research and policy contributions into technical education, teaching, careers, international models and success driving thought leadership and policy in further education (FE). 4. The organisation, judging and validation of national skills competitions, boosting standards and aspirations of FE colleges and providers. 5. The selection, training and preparation of "Team UK" members through a two-year cycle to ensure UK representation and strong performance at international skills competitions promoting the UK's reputation as a high skill economy. DfE will gather market intelligence via issuing a Request for Information (RFI) to all suppliers interested in providing commercial insight. Following the RFI process, we will assess the responses and consider the next steps to ensure that the WorldSkills UK programme delivers good value for money and best quality whilst ensuring a compatible strategic fit with the government's priorities.
